With Prem Ratan Dhan Payo striking gold at the box office and Bajrangi Bhaijaan shattering records all over, Salman Khan has now become the first and the only Bollywood actorto have clocked Rs. 500 crores in a single year at the India box office. But with PRDP still holding strong at the box office, despite newer releases, the film holds enough steam to continue its
solo run this week enabling Salman to come within striking distance of the Rs. 550 crores target at the India box office.
However, it isn't just this year that Salman has been topping the box office charts, in fact in 2012, Salman Khan's two releases (Ek Tha Tiger and Dabangg 2) had grossed approximately
Rs. 353 crores at the India Box office whereas in 2014, his film Jai Ho and Kick combined collected approximately Rs. 346 crores. However with this year's collections, Salman Khan has broken his
own record.
On the other hand, when it comes to actresses, readers may recollect that Deepika Padukone had grossed Rs. 632.48 crores from her 4 releases Race 2, Yeh Jawaani Hai Deewani, Chennai Express
and Goliyon Ki Raasleela Ram Leela in the year 2013.
However with Aamir Khan, working on a solo release every year, chances are that Salman's record might go uncontested. But, all said and done, with Shah Rukh Khan gearing up with two releases next
year, he is well in contention to challenge Salman's supremacy. Now the big question is 'Will Shah Rukh Khan top Salman's yearly box office collections or won't he?', only 2016 will tell.

Movie | Release | Lifetime (Cr.) |
---|---|---|
Ek Tha Tiger | 15-Aug-12 | 198.78 |
Dabangg 2 | 21-Dec-12 | 155.00 |
TOTAL for 2012 | 353.78 | |
 |  |  |
Jai Ho | 24-Jan-14 | 116.00 |
Kick | 25-Jul-14 | 230.69 |
TOTAL for 2014 | 346.69 | |
 |  |  |
Bajrangi Bhaijaan | 17-Jul-15 | 320.34 |
Prem Ratan Dhan Payo | 12-Nov-15 | 208.88 |
TOTAL for 2015 | 529.22 |
